Why we disagree about Climate Change
Event
Why we disagree about Climate Change
Academic
Dr Reiner Grundmann
Academic school
School of Languages and Social Sciences
Research group
Sociology & public policy
Summary
Climate change is not only about scientific facts to be discovered or problems to be solved. It represents the different ideas, values and interests attached to our collective goals and aspirations. You will understand the scientific, political and cultural aspects which make climate change such a difficult and controversial issue. Main speaker: Prof Mike Hulme from the University of East Anglia
